What's more precious than gemstones? Kids and their ponies, of course. The Michigan Hoof Beat is celebrating one lucky kid and her Christmas pony.

Lucy Rinke, age 9, of Plymouth, welcomed Leo's Double Eyed Jewel home in time for Christmas, writes mother Melissa Rinke.
"We had been searching for our first horse for a few months when Leo’s Double Eyed Jewel, aka Jewel, came into our lives," writes Melissa.

The Rinkes are care-leasing Jewel, a 22-year-old mare who produced one colt of her own in 2011, Rinke says.

Jewel is being boarded at a farm in Ypsilanti and "will be the perfect horse for our 4-H adventures," Rinke wrote in a December email to The Michigan Hoof Beat.
